Strain Gauges
Strain gauges are devices used to measure strain forces on materials. The most common consists of an insulating flexible backing with a metallic foil pattern. The gauge is attached to an object with a suitable adhesive. As the object is deformed, the flexible backing and foil are deformed, causing a change in electrical resistance. This resistance change is usually measured with a Wheatstone bridge.
